Reps. Omar, Craig Find Empty ICE Cells at Whipple

Minnesota Representatives Ilhan Omar and Angie Craig conducted congressional oversight at the Whipple Federal Building and found holding cells completely empty during their visit. The lawmakers had previously been denied access to the facility, raising concerns about transparency in federal immigration operations.

During the oversight visit, Rep. Angie Craig said ICE agents appeared to have cleared detainees from the facility just 30 minutes before their arrival. The representatives criticized policies requiring congressional members to provide week-long notice before conducting oversight visits, arguing this undermines their constitutional oversight duties. They also noted that approximately 500 ICE agents are currently operating in Minnesota under Operation Metro Surge.

Reps. Omar and Craig reported that federal immigration enforcement in Minnesota currently conducts about 20 detentions per day and operates two deportation flights weekly. Border Czar Tom Homan has returned to Washington, D.C., while the acting director of federal immigration enforcement provided the representatives with current operational data. The lawmakers emphasized their commitment to ensuring transparency in immigration enforcement and maintaining their constitutional right to conduct oversight without advance notice.
